APSO investigating a double-murder suicide in Prairieville

ASCENSION – Ascension Parish Sheriff's Office is investigating a double-murder suicide that occurred on Sunday around 1 p.m.

Deputies responded to a home on Oak Trace Road in Prairieville in reference to a neighbor hearing a gunshot that came from inside the home.
37-year-old Shawn Millet, is believed to have killed 31-year-old Lacey Leblanc of Walker and her 8-year-old daughter inside the home and then shot himself.

Millet was transported to a local hospital where he later died from his injuries.

During the investigation, it was learned that Millet and Leblanc met online 6 months ago. Leblanc and her daughter were visiting Millet's home and all three were last seen on the porch Saturday night.

Deputies later learning that Millet has a criminal history of domestic abuse battery and cruelty to juveniles.
An autopsy will be performed to determine the exact cause of death of Leblanc and her daughter. The case is still under investigation.
